Storage
Your computer's all-in-one design offers a variety of data storage options:
•
The high capacity Enhanced-IDE hard disk drive.
The hard drive is upgradeable, enabling you to increase your storage
capacity in the future. Consult your dealer if you need to upgrade.
•
The high speed optical drive.
Depending on your model, you have a CD-ROM, DVD-ROM, or DVD/CD-
RW combo drive. The optical drive provides increased storage capacity,
as well as offering a host of multimedia possibilities.

Ejecting the optical drive tray
To eject the optical drive tray:
•
With the computer turned on, press the optical drive eject button.
•
The tray will be released, and partially pop open.
•
Gently pull the tray out to its limit.
